Ecology Control Industries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Ecology Control Industries in the United States is $45.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$94,423. Salaries at Ecology Control Industries typically range from $40 to $51 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Los Angeles?

Understanding the cost of living near Los Angeles is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Ecology Control Industries.
Los Angeles' Cost of Living Index is approximately 173.3 (73.3% more expensive than US average; 23.9% more than CA average). Driven by extremely expensive housing, high transportation costs, and above-average goods/services.
